RWA Tokenization
The process of creating a digital twin of a Real-World Asset (like real estate, gold, or debt) on a blockchain, allowing it to be traded globally 24/7.
Zero-Knowledge Proof
A cryptographic method by which one party can prove to another that a statement is true without revealing any information apart from the fact that the statement is true.
